Biography
Dr. Adebowale Adeniran is an experienced surgical pathologist and cytopathologist, and currently Director of Cytopathology and the Cytology Laboratory and Director of Cytopathology Fellowship Program. Dr. Adeniran obtained his MD degree from the University of Ibadan, Nigeria. He did his anatomic/clinical pathology residency at the University of Cincinnati Medical Center, followed by surgical pathology fellowship (with special interest in genitourinary pathology) at the University of Texas M.D. Anderson Cancer Center and cytopathology fellowship at the Memorial Sloan-Kettering Cancer Center. Dr. Adeniran is a practicing surgical and cyto pathologist, with a research focus on clinico-pathologic and molecular pathologic aspects of kidney cancer as well as thyroid cancer. He is an editorial board member of Cancer Cytopathology and Journal of Clinical and Translational Pathology, and a reviewer of several peer-reviewed journals. He has authored more than 130 manuscripts and book chapters, and co-authored two textbooks - Common Diagnostic Pitfalls in Thyroid Cytopathology and Rapid On-site Evaluation (ROSE): A Practical Guide. He currently serves as a member of the education committee of the United States and Canadian Academy of Pathology.
